Современные технологии предлагают широкий ассортимент различных интерфейсов. Это особые зоны взаимодействия между системами или их частями, которые позволяют обмениваться данными и инструкциями. Интерфейсы играют важную роль в упрощении взаимодействия пользователя с техникой, поскольку создают единый язык общения между сложными техническими системами и человеком.
В понятийном поле пользовательских интерфейсов мы можем выделить ряд значимых классификаций— это позволяет лучше понимать их назначение и область применения. Благодаря такому подходу, проектировщики интерфейсов могут создавать продукты, максимально адаптированные под нужды конечных пользователей и бизнес-систем.
Наш перечень типов интерфейсов составлен на базе современных данных и теорий проектирования пользовательских интерфейсов. Разнообразие этого списка подчеркивает глубину и многогранность данной сферы, а также наглядно демонстрирует, насколько многие аспекты нашей жизни связаны с технологиями и их применением.
Сравнение аналоговых и цифровых вариантов интерфейсов
Аналоговые и цифровые интерфейсы имеют одну общую цель – передачу данных, однако механизм достижения этой цели разный для каждого из типов. Выявление главных характеристик каждого вида интерфейса поможет потребителям выбрать наиболее подходящий вариант для своих нужд.
Аналоговые против цифровых интерфейсов: основные отличия
Аналоговые интерфейсы передают данные в виде непрерывного потока сигналов, что обеспечивает более мягкое и естественное воспроизведение звуков или изображений. Однако такой механизм передачи данных является более подверженным к внешним помехам, что может привести к ошибкам в передаче и искажению результата.
Цифровые интерфейсы, напротив, переводят все данные в бинарный код, состоящий из единиц и нолей, перед отправкой. Это увеличивает устойчивость передачи данных к внешним помехам, и позволяет добиться более высокой точности при воспроизведении. К тому же, такой формат данных обеспечивает возможность компрессии, что позволяет экономить место хранения.
- Аналоговые интерфейсы обеспечивают более естественное воспроизведение, но подвержены искажению.
- Цифровые интерфейсы обеспечивают высокую точность воспроизведения, устойчивости к помехам и возможность компрессии данных.
В конечном итоге выбор между аналоговыми и цифровыми интерфейсами будет зависеть от специфических требований и предпочтений пользователя.
Преимущества и недостатки графического интерфейса пользователя
Графический интерфейс пользователя, или, как его еще называют, GUI, стал основой современного взаимодействия людей с цифровыми устройствами. Это система, которая использует визуальные образы и метафоры для представления функций и данных, с которыми работает пользователь. Но каковы плюсы и минусы такого подхода?
GUI вышел на первый план благодаря своей интуитивности и простоте использования. Однако, как любое решение в области технологий, он не лишен и отрицательных сторон. Рассмотрим подробнее.
Преимущества GUI
- Интуитивность и простота использования. Пользователям легче работать с визуальными образами, чем с командной строкой или текстовыми меню.
- Мультимедийные возможности. Большинство графических интерфейсов может воспроизводить звук, изображения и видео, что делает их более привлекательными для пользователя.
- Стандартизация. GUI обеспечивает единый подход к оформлению и управлению приложениями, что упрощает обучение и переход от одной программы к другой.
Недостатки GUI
- Большие требования к ресурсам. Графические интерфейсы обычно требуют больше оперативной памяти и мощности процессора, чем их текстовые аналоги.
- Меньшая гибкость. Все варианты действий и настроек уже предусмотрены разработчиками, и пользователи не имеют такой степени контроля, которую могут предложить консольные интерфейсы.
- Скорость работы. Ввод команд с помощью мыши и меню может быть медленнее, чем ввод команд с клавиатуры в текстовом интерфейсе.
Кому может быть полезен командный интерфейс?
Командный интерфейс, известный также как CLI (command line interface), представляет собой стиль взаимодействия между пользователем и программой, где все команды вводятся вручную с помощью клавиатуры. Этот тип интерфейса может казаться устаревшим и неприветливым для пользователя на фоне современных графических интерфейсов, однако, для многих специалистов, он остается неоспоримо ценным.
Применение командного интерфейса характерно, прежде всего, в технической сфере, в особенности среди программистов и системных администраторов. Ключевым его преимуществом является возможность быстрого выполнения сложных операций, сопровождающихся подробными параметрами и настройками, что важно в профессиональной среде.
Основные аудитории использования CLI:
- Системные администраторы. Для них командная строка становится абсолютно незаменимым инструментом для осуществления взаимодействия с операционной системой, настройки сетевого оборудования, установки и обновления программного обеспечения и многих других задач.
- Программисты. Используя командный интерфейс, разработчики могут управлять компиляторами, отладчиками и другими инструментами, а также быстро реализовывать сложные манипуляции с файлами и каталогами.
- ДевОпс-специалисты. В своей работе они активно используют CLI для автоматизации рабочих процессов и управления облачными сервисами и платформами.
Таким образом, несмотря на сложность освоения и использования, командный интерфейс может быть незаменимым помощником для определенной категории специалистов, предъявляющих сложные и детальные требования к производительности и скорости работы с программами и системами.
Применение пользовательских интерфейсов с направленной функциональностью в области веб-дизайна
Основным преимуществом этого подхода является оптимизация взаимодействия с веб-сайтом для пользователя. Все действия пользователя становятся более ясными и предсказуемыми, исключаются возможные ошибки или затруднения при использовании сайта.
Сферы применения направленных пользовательских интерфейсов
Системы с направленной функциональностью активно используются при веб-дизайне различных типов сайтов. Давайте рассмотрим некоторые из них:
- Интернет-магазины: При работе с любым интернет-магазином пользователь ведется по определенной дорожке, начиная от выбора товара и заканчивая оформлением заказа. Все этапы оформления покупки четко структурированы, что облегчает процесс покупки.
- Сайты образовательных ресурсов: Для эффективного обучения онлайн необходимо организовать путь пользователя таким образом, чтобы все материалы были последовательно пройдены. Направленные интерфейсы помогают структурировать этот процесс.
- Сайты государственных структур: При использовании государственных услуг онлайн важно, чтобы пользовательский процесс был максимально прозрачным и понятным. Направленные интерфейсы обеспечивают простоту и понятность процессов.
Также, направленные интерфейсы эффективно применяются для мобильных приложений, предоставляющих ограниченное количество функций и направленных на удобство и простоту использования.
Текстовые интерфейсы: просвет в историю
Текстовые интерфейсы, основанные на вводе и выводе текстовой информации, обеспечивали высокую скорость работы и минимальные требования к системным ресурсам. В отличие от их графических собратьев, такие интерфейсы не жадны до ресурсов, предлагая вместо этого простоту и максимальную функциональность.
Аспекты текстовых интерфейсов
Утилитарность и прямота — отличительные черты текстовых интерфейсов. Все делается через напрямую введенные команды, что может быть непривычно для пользователей, привыкших к иконкам и визуальным меню. Однако эта прямота обусловила и создание скриптов — последовательностей команд, которые обрабатываются автоматически. Таким образом, текстовый интерфейс стал основой для более сложных программных решений.
Что же до недостатков таких решений, то здесь стоит упомянуть необходимость знать конкретные команды и принципы их работы. Этот факт сделал текстовые интерфейсы менее интуитивными в сравнении с графическими.
- Высокая скорость работы
- Минимальные требования к системным ресурсам
- Возможность создания скриптов
- Необходимость знать конкретные команды
- Ограниченная интуитивность
Таким образом, несмотря на кажущуюся простоту и устаревшую на первый взгляд концепцию, текстовые интерфейсы остаются важным инструментом в арсенале программистов и системных администраторов.
Развитие тактильных интерфейсов: ближайшие перспективы
Современные технологии стремительно развиваются, при этом все большую роль играют тактильные интерфейсы. Они позволяют пользователям взаимодействовать с цифровыми устройствами с помощью осязательных ощущений. Этот подход значительно расширяет возможности взаимодействия человека и машины.
Пока что наиболее распространенными тактильными устройствами являются смартфоны, планшеты и игровые контроллеры с функцией виброотклика. Однако перспективы развития в этом направлении представляются крайне обширными.
Будущее тактильных интерфейсов
Возможности применения тактильных интерфейсов не ограничиваются одним только бытовым использованием. Профессиональные сферы, такие как медицина, образование, автомобильная промышленность и многие другие, также могут извлечь огромную пользу из прогресса в этой области.
- Медицина: Разработка тактильных интерфейсов может привести к созданию более продвинутых протезов, перчаток для врачей, позволяющих ощущать пациента на расстоянии и т. д.
- Образование: Использование тактильных устройств позволит студентам и младшим учащимся получать ощутимый опыт в реальном мире, не рискуя при этом своей безопасностью.
- Автомобильная промышленность: С помощью тактильной обратной связи водители смогут лучше ощущать состояние своего автомобиля и реагировать на любые изменения.
В общем, тактильные интерфейсы, несмотря на то, что они еще находятся в начальной стадии развития, уже имеют прорывной потенциал. Этот тип взаимодействия c цифровыми устройствами может серьезно изменить многие аспекты нашей жизни, делая ее более удобной и безопасной.
Коммуникативные возможности через обмен сообщениями
Современные формы взаимодействия и обмена информацией предполагают широкий спектр инструментов и методов взаимодействия. Благодаря развитию цифровых технологий, обмен сообщениями стал одним из главных способов коммуникации, к которому прибегают люди в повседневной жизни. Часто для этих целей используют собственный интерфейс обмена сообщениями.
Такая форма коммуникации имеет ряд преимуществ. Во-первых, она позволяет вести более структурированную и организованную переписку. Во-вторых, быстрый и эффективный обмен сообщениями повышает производительность и эффективность коммуникации.
Основные элементы интерфейса для обмена сообщениями
Функционал, предоставляемый интерфейсом для обмена сообщениями, включает в себя следующие категории:
- Входящие и исходящие сообщения — Обычно электронная почта имеет отдельные разделы для входящих и исходящих сообщений. Так можно легко следить за перепиской и не пропустить важную информацию.
- Чаты и групповые диалоги — Для обмена мгновенными сообщениями используются специализированные платформы и приложения. В них можно создавать отдельные чаты для каждой беседы.
- Функция поиска — В большинстве приложений для обмена сообщениями есть функция поиска, чтобы найти определенную беседу или сообщение.
Таким образом, интерфейс для обмена сообщениями включает в себя многочисленные инструменты, которые обеспечивают эффективность и удобство коммуникации.
Изобретательность в области необычных пользовательских интерфейсов
Изобретательность разработчиков в области создания необычных интерфейсов удивляет своим разнообразием и новаторством. С внедрением новейших технологий поток свежих идей не иссякает. И это касается не только вариантов визуализации информации, но и форматов ее ввода и обработки.
Примеры необычных интерфейсов
- Альтернативные устройства ввода: сенсорные перчатки, трек-болы, бесклавиатурные клавиатуры и прочее. Их использование способно облегчить взаимодействие с устройством для специфических групп пользователей — например, людей с ограниченными возможностями.
- Объемные проекции: это могут быть как трехмерные модели на обычных экранах, так и реализованные с помощью специального оборудования виртуальные реальности.
- Голосовые интерфейсы: контроль устройством с помощью голосовых команд — от простого управления функциями смартфона до сложных систем управления домашней техникой в концепции умного дома.
- Биометрические интерфейсы: использование уникальных физиологических или поведенческих характеристик человека (например, отпечатков пальцев, распознавания лиц или голоса) для обеспечения безопасности и удобства использования.
Каждый из этих форматов требует индивидуального подхода и тщательной проработки, но при должном качестве выполнения они способны открыть совершенно новые возможности для пользователя.
Эволюция интерфейсов: взаимодействие через жесты
С тех пор, как компьютеры впервые появились, взаимодействие человека и машины прошло долгий путь эволюции. Если раньше основным способом были клавиатура и мышь, то сегодня, исследователи и разработчики все более активно применяют режимы ввода, максимально приближенные к естественному взаимодействию человека с окружающим миром.
Стремление к естественности и интуитивности в управлении техникой привело к развитию нового направления в интерфейсах — жестовых. Эти интерфейсы предлагают новый способ взаимодействия, где устройства реагируют на движения пользователя, а не на нажатия клавиш или сенсорный ввод.
Насколько распространены жестовые интерфейсы?
Жестовые интерфейсы быстро набирают популярность в различных областях. Видеоигры, виртуальная и дополненная реальность, системы автоматического управления, робототехника — все это направления, где уже сегодня применяются технологии распознавания жестов.
- В игровой индустрии, игроки могут управлять персонажами, взаимодействовать с игровым окружением, не прикасаясь к контроллеру — достаточно просто движения руками в воздухе.
- Системы виртуальной и дополненной реальности также все более активно используют жестовые интерфейсы. Здесь, движение рук пользователя преобразуется в действия в виртуальном пространстве.
- В области робототехники, жестовые интерфейсы позволяют общаться и управлять роботами, превращая движения в команды.
Мы стоим на пороге новой эры связи с технологией, область применения жестовых интерфейсов становится все шире. Они способствуют развитию более естественного, интуитивного взаимодействия с техникой, и по праву могут считаться одной из ключевых технологий будущего.
Великолепное будущее интерфейсов с D и виртуальной реальностью
Основной преимущественной особенностью применимости трёхмерных и виртуальных технологий является их вовлекательность и реалистичность. Интерфейсы, основанные на этих технологиях, позволяют пользователю иммерсироваться в цифровую реальность, увеличивая вовлечённость и улучшая взаимодействие.
Сферы применения D и виртуальных интерфейсов
- Образование: 3D и VR помогают создавать интерактивные уроки, симуляции и эксперименты, поднимая образовательный процесс на новый уровень.
- Здравоохранение: моделирование и визуализация сложных медицинских процедур и операций в 3D помогают в подготовке медицинских работников.
- Проектирование и строительство: 3D и VR помогают моделировать и визуализировать будущие строительные проекты.
- Развлечения и игры: виртуальная реальность придаёт новые ощущения и возможности в мире компьютерных игр и развлечений.
Таким образом, можно сказать, что D и виртуальные интерфейсы уже активно меняют наше будущее настоящее, предоставляя новые возможности и преимущества в различных областях жизни.
FAQ: Типы интерфейсов
Что такое D в контексте виртуальных интерфейсов?
В данном контексте под D, скорее всего, подразумевается D programming language — язык программирования D, разработанный для написания и управления большими пакетами программного обеспечения с высокоэффективным управлением памятью и безопасностью типов данных.
Почему говорят, что будущее уже здесь относительно виртуальных интерфейсов?
Виртуальные интерфейсы с каждым днем становятся все более востребованными и разнообразными. Они позволяют упростить работу пользователя с компьютером, сделать ее более удобной и быстрой. Многие функции, которые раньше казались недостижимыми, теперь стали реальностью.
Как Д язык относится к виртуальным интерфейсам?
Язык D хорошо подходит для создания сложных систем, которые могут включать виртуальные интерфейсы. Он обладает мощной системой типов, что позволяет создавать безопасные и надежные приложения.
Каковы перспективы использования виртуальных интерфейсов?
Перспективы использования виртуальных интерфейсов велики. Они могут использоваться во многих отраслях: от IT до медицины и образования. Виртуальные интерфейсы могут значительно упростить и ускорить работу, а также открыть новые возможности для развития различных отраслей.
Какие могут быть проблемы с виртуальными интерфейсами?
Несмотря на множество преимуществ, виртуальные интерфейсы также имеют свои недостатки. Одним из них является сложность разработки и поддержки со стороны разработчиков. Кроме того, не все пользователи могут быстро освоить новый интерфейс, особенно если он значительно отличается от привычного.
Что такое D интерфейс?
D интерфейс является мощным средством для работы с виртуальной реальностью и другими формами цифрового взаимодействия. Он предлагает новые возможности визуализации и манипулирования данными.
Какие возможности открывают виртуальные интерфейсы?
Виртуальные интерфейсы могут полностью изменить способ взаимодействия с цифровыми системами. Они позволяют визуально представлять и манипулировать данные в трехмерном пространстве, полностью погружая пользователя в интерактивную цифровую среду.
В чем заключается преимущества D и виртуальных интерфейсов?
Преимущества D и виртуальных интерфейсов заключаются, прежде всего, в улучшенном пользовательском опыте. Они обеспечивают более глубокое понимание данных и лучшую навигацию, что, в свою очередь, может приводить к более эффективному принятию решений.
Что подразумевается под «будущее уже здесь» в контексте D и виртуальных интерфейсов?
Это означает, что технологии, которые раньше считались научной фантастикой или выглядели далекими и недоступными, теперь являются реальностью. Виртуальные интерфейсы и D внедряются в различные области, от развлекательной индустрии до образования и медицины.
Как D и виртуальные интерфейсы могут влиять на образование?
Они открывают новые возможности для обучения и научных исследований. С помощью виртуальной реальности становится возможным создавать трехмерные модели и симуляции, которые могут помочь студентам лучше понять сложные концепции и идеи.